India defeat New Zealand by 4 wickets to win ICC Champions Trophy 2025

DUBAI – India clinched the ICC Champions Trophy 2025 title by defeating New Zealand by 4 wickets in the final at Dubai International Cricket Stadium. Batting first, New Zealand posted … Continue reading India defeat New Zealand by 4 wickets to win ICC Champions Trophy 2025